TYPE: Print-ready sticker sheet (sponsor decal sheet style), clean 2D vector look.
CANVAS / PRINT:
- 2480 x 3508 px, 300 DPI (A4), portrait
- Bleed: 3mm
- Safe margin: 5mm (no sticker may cross into margin)
- Background: pure white (#FFFFFF), flat
STICKER CUT SYSTEM (CONSISTENT ACROSS ALL):
For each logo:
1) Die-cut outline: thick WHITE kiss-cut border (uniform thickness)
2) Visibility stroke: thin LIGHT-GRAY stroke outside the white border (so it reads on white paper)
3) Shadow: subtle soft drop shadow (offset 6–10 px, blur 12–18 px, opacity 12–18%), print-clean
SIZE CONSTRAINTS (STRICT):
Each sticker must fit inside:
- Max width: 945 px (8 cm)
- Max height: 709 px (6 cm)
- Min height: 354 px (3 cm)
Vary sizes but never exceed maxima.

LAYOUT ENGINEERING (PACKING LIKE A SPONSOR SHEET):
- Use a dense, balanced collage layout:
- Top third: 3–4 “hero” logos at larger size (still within max size)
- Middle: 14–16 medium logos arranged in staggered rows
- Bottom: remaining smaller logos filling gaps cleanly
- No overlaps, no cropping, consistent gutters
- Maintain visual rhythm: mostly 3 logos per row for medium/large, up to 4 per row for smaller ones
- Keep overall composition centered with even whitespace around edges
RENDER PARAMETERS:
- Camera: orthographic straight-on, 85mm equivalent, f/8 (maximum crispness)
- Lighting: uniform studio lighting; shadow only comes from the sticker drop shadow
- Output: ultra-sharp edges, accurate logo geometry, print-ready clarity
'''A highly technical prompt for generating a print-ready sticker sheet featuring 28 specific tech stack logos (e.g., Python, Docker, AWS). It mandates strict constraints on size, layout, color, and technical printing details like bleed, margin, and kiss-cut outlines, aiming for a clean 2D vector look with a subtle drop shadow.
